If not, see . # from __future__ import absolute_import, division, print_function __metaclass__ = type DOCUMENTATION = """ module: ios_bgp author: Nilashish Chakraborty (@NilashishC) short_description: Module to configure BGP protocol settings. description: - This module provides configuration management of global BGP parameters on devices running Cisco IOS version_added: 1.0.0 deprecated: alternative: ios_bgp_global why: Newer and updated modules released with more functionality removed_at_date: '2023-08-24' notes: - Tested against Cisco IOS Version 15.6(3)M2 options: config: description: - Specifies the BGP related configuration. type: dict suboptions: bgp_as: description: - Specifies the BGP Autonomous System (AS) number to configure on the device. type: int required: true router_id: description: - Configures the BGP routing process router-id value. type: str default: log_neighbor_changes: description: - Enable/disable logging neighbor up/down and reset reason. type: bool neighbors: description: - Specifies BGP neighbor related configurations. type: list elements: dict suboptions: neighbor: description: - Neighbor router address. required: true type: str remote_as: description: - Remote AS of the BGP neighbor to configure. type: int required: true update_source: description: - Source of the routing updates. type: str password: description: - Password to authenticate the BGP peer connection. type: str enabled: description: - Administratively shutdown or enable a neighbor. type: bool description: description: - Neighbor specific description. type: str ebgp_multihop: description: - Specifies the maximum hop count for EBGP neighbors not on directly connected networks. - The range is from 1 to 255. type: int peer_group: description: - Name of the peer group that the neighbor is a member of. type: str timers: description: - Specifies BGP neighbor timer related configurations. type: dict suboptions: keepalive: description: - Frequency (in seconds) with which the device sends keepalive messages to its peer. - The range is from 0 to 65535. type: int required: true holdtime: description: - Interval (in seconds) after not receiving a keepalive message that IOS declares a peer dead. - The range is from 0 to 65535. type: int required: true min_neighbor_holdtime: description: - Interval (in seconds) specifying the minimum acceptable hold-time from a BGP neighbor. - The minimum acceptable hold-time must be less than, or equal to, the interval specified in the holdtime argument. - The range is from 0 to 65535. type: int local_as: description: - The local AS number for the neighbor. type: int networks: description: - Specify Networks to announce via BGP. - For operation replace, this option is mutually exclusive with networks option under address_family. - For operation replace, if the device already has an address family activated, this option is not allowed. type: list elements: dict suboptions: prefix: description: - Network ID to announce via BGP. required: true type: str masklen: description: - Subnet mask length for the Network to announce(e.g, 8, 16, 24, etc.). type: int route_map: description: - Route map to modify the attributes. type: str address_family: description: - Specifies BGP address family related configurations. type: list elements: dict suboptions: afi: description: - Type of address family to configure. choices: - ipv4 - ipv6 required: true type: str safi: description: - Specifies the type of cast for the address family. choices: - flowspec - unicast - multicast - labeled-unicast default: unicast type: str synchronization: description: - Enable/disable IGP synchronization. type: bool auto_summary: description: - Enable/disable automatic network number summarization. type: bool redistribute: description: - Specifies the redistribute information from another routing protocol. type: list elements: dict suboptions: protocol: description: - Specifies the protocol for configuring redistribute information. choices: - ospf - ospfv3 - eigrp - isis - static - connected - odr - lisp - mobile - rip required: true type: str id: description: - Identifier for the routing protocol for configuring redistribute information. - Valid for protocols 'ospf', 'ospfv3' and 'eigrp'. type: str metric: description: - Specifies the metric for redistributed routes. type: int route_map: description: - Specifies the route map reference. type: str networks: description: - Specify Networks to announce via BGP. - For operation replace, this option is mutually exclusive with root level networks option. type: list elements: dict suboptions: prefix: description: - Network ID to announce via BGP. required: true type: str masklen: description: - Subnet mask length for the Network to announce(e.g, 8, 16, 24, etc.). type: int route_map: description: - Route map to modify the attributes. type: str neighbors: description: - Specifies BGP neighbor related configurations in Address Family configuration mode. type: list elements: dict suboptions: neighbor: description: - Neighbor router address. required: true type: str advertisement_interval: description: - Minimum interval between sending BGP routing updates for this neighbor. type: int route_reflector_client: description: - Specify a neighbor as a route reflector client. type: bool route_server_client: description: - Specify a neighbor as a route server client. type: bool activate: description: - Enable the Address Family for this Neighbor. type: bool remove_private_as: description: - Remove the private AS number from outbound updates. type: bool next_hop_self: description: - Enable/disable the next hop calculation for this neighbor. type: bool next_hop_unchanged: description: - Propagate next hop unchanged for iBGP paths to this neighbor. type: bool maximum_prefix: description: - Maximum number of prefixes to accept from this peer. - The range is from 1 to 2147483647. type: int prefix_list_in: description: - Name of ip prefix-list to apply to incoming prefixes. type: str prefix_list_out: description: - Name of ip prefix-list to apply to outgoing prefixes. type: str operation: description: - Specifies the operation to be performed on the BGP process configured on the device. - In case of merge, the input configuration will be merged with the existing BGP configuration on the device. - In case of replace, if there is a diff between the existing configuration and the input configuration, the existing configuration will be replaced by the input configuration for every option that has the diff. - In case of override, all the existing BGP configuration will be removed from the device and replaced with the input configuration. - In case of delete the existing BGP configuration will be removed from the device. default: merge type: str choices: -
